Château Léoville Poyferré St Julien 1855 2ième Cru 2004

Chocolate, liquorice, olive tapendade, brambled blackberry and cassis fruits, firm tannins. Deepens through the palate, showcasing layers of flavour that offer both power and concentration. An excellent Poyferré that offsets the seriousness of the vintage with the signature exuberance and pleasure of the estate. Needs a carafe for a few hours as still pretty tight on opening. Harvest September 30 to October 18. 80% new oak.
